Very Chocolate Ice Cream

Reviewed: May 29, 2012
This was the PERFECT chocolate ice cream recipe!! Taste and texture were spot on... I felt like I was putting frozen ganache in my mouth... I did double the amount of semisweet chocolate (I used Ghirardelli chips), but I don't know that it was necessary. As another reviewer mentioned: DO NOT BOIL, make sure your chocolate is in small pieces (GRATE if possible), and use the best chocolate that fits your budget. You'll LOVE the results. O, and if you can find it... use MEXICAN Vanilla!!

Best Ever Jalapeno Poppers

Reviewed: Dec. 25, 2010
This is a good recipe with room to play! I leave out the bacon (not the flavor I wanted), add a couple cloves of garlic, 1 tsp onion powder and maybe 1/2 tsp salt to cream cheese mix. I pipe the filling using a zip lock bag, less mess! I use panko bread crumbs for the second dip, and fine bread crumbs for the third dip, and sprinkle the poppers with salt before the third drying... very crunchy, very good! My husband is an absolute FIEND for these, and after trying several recipes, this is the one we've settled on as our favorite. Thanks for such a good post!
